Brussels, 20/03/2013 (Agence Europe) - On Wednesday 20 March, the civil liberties committee at the European Parliament went into close detail, with its presentation of 3,133 amendments to the draft report of Jan-Philip Albrecht (Greens/EFA) on the regulation on personal data protection. The report drafted by Dimitrios Droutsas (S&D), focusing on the directive covering areas of police and legal cooperation, drew more than 670 amendments.
